 Restless leg syndrome
Good morning,
My husband has suffered with this for years, and we have finally found something that works, Lavender Oil. Anybody have any other ideas or recipes that we can try. Thanks

 Re: Restless leg syndrome
Sounds like something calming, like Roman or Cape chamomile. Along with the Lavender, these are considered the most relaxing...you might try samples of Helichrysum, Plai, Turmeric and Ginger as well...anti-inflammatory, and might further enhance effect. Use in Borage Seed oil for best results.
